Many arenas have this design. Some have seats on the court level, others don't. There is more space at the baseline than the sideline.

Floors get removed and reinstalled often. Philly, Detroit, Boston, LA, etc. They all have this design.

One sticky part is that each book covers 1 day in the frame. So Kote's story telling and other things going on in the frame should all amount to the relatively the same amount of time - give or take some off-page time.

Someone went back and calculate how long Kote is actually talking in book 2. When you add up the time, it is much longer than a 24 hour day.... The second day also seems much longer than day 1. Then if you add in all the other things in the frame, it is even longer. I believe there is a retcon that Pat never said a day is 24 hours in the books.

Thanks, Fela is called, "Re'lar Fela" when we first meet her in NoTW.

I have read this to mean that Fela was promoted Re'lar during admissions. As we see in admissions, a Master sponsors someone to raise them, then the other Masters vote. She is a Scriv so I've thought that she was sponsored by Master Lorren.

While in WMF, Elodin raises her to Re'lar Fela by himself. I see this as Elodin raising her in the old, traditional sense. She is now a "speaker".

Two points in response:

First, Cinder and Breden may be different faces or masks to the same person - Ferrule.

Second, even if the above doesn't seem likely to you, the Cthaeh never said that Kvothe saw Cinder only twice. It is never that clear. "I'd say it was a twice-in-a-lifetime-opportunity meeting up with him again." Lots of wiggle room.

“Pity he got away,” the Cthaeh continued. “Still, you must admit you’ve had quite a piece of luck. I’d say it was a twice-in-a-lifetime-opportunity meeting up with him again. Pity you wasted it. Don’t feel bad you didn’t recognize him. They have a lot of experience hiding those telltale signs.

Naming seems to be the ability to know the true name with the sleeping mind. Shaping and knowing are two different things.

Shapers, at least from what we see, can essentially do anything they want. You can turn stone to dust, turn stone to any shape, cause earthquakes, etc.

If you know a person, you can change a person's entire being, kill a person, control them like a puppet, etc.

You can make an ever burning lamp, swords that don't dull, etc.

Imagine someone knowing the name of water. In war, they can vaporize an entire city's water supply, suck the water from flesh, etc.

From what we see, the limit seems to (1) be bring someone back from the dead and then letting them die again, and (2) reconnect two realms that have been split.
